Base de datos

Timeline created by Andre500
  • 1960

    Uso de los archivos separados ISAM (Index Sequencial Access Method) y VSAM
    (Virtual StorGE Access Method) fueron sistemas administradores de archivos.
  • 1964

    El término Base de datos, primero usado en las Fuerzas Militares de EEUU aparece en las
    publicaciones. IBM introduce IDS (Almacén de Datos Integrado).
  • 1969

    IBM introduce IMS, una base de datos jerárquica envió su primer informe a la PLC,
    proponiendo un Lenguaje de Descripción de Datos (DLL) para describir una base de
    datos y un Lenguaje de Manipulación de Datos (DML). Los primeros SGBD Gobernadores de Bases de Datos) se caracterizan por la separación de la descripción de
    los datos de la manipulación de estos por los programas de aplicación.
  • 1970

    E.F. Codd hizo un documento describiendo el modelo relacional (definición de modelo
    relacional) basado en la simplicidad matemática del álgebra relacional.
  • 1971

    Se produjo un informe (DBTG) surgiendo por primera vez dos lenguajes de descripción
    de datos, uno para el esquema y otro para el subesquema.
    Se forma una comisión llamada Comisión de Lenguajes de descripción de Datos (DDLC).
  • 1972

    Finales de 1971 y principios de este año aparece el primer borrador del modelo Codasyl
    con una arquitectura con una arquitectura de dos niveles: un esquema que proporciona la
    vista del sistema y un subesquema que proporciona la vista del sistema y un subesquema
    que proporciona la vista del usuario.
  • 1973

    La DDLC publicó su propuesta en el Journal od Development, reconociendo que le
    proceso de desarrollo en lenguajes de bases de datos debería ser evolutivo (COBOL).
  • 1976

    DER Chen. Surge el SQL. Chen introduce el modelo entidad-vínculo (ER)
  • 1977

    Oracle Corp. Se establece. Surge QUEL (Quero Lenguaje) del sistema INGRES. Surge el
    lenguaje QBE (Quero by Example) desarrollado por IBM.
  • 1978

    Oracle hace la primera implementación real del modelo relacional. La comisión técnica
    X3H2 ha comenzado a estandarizar el modelo de red.
    Se lanzó una definición borrador de un esquema de almacenamiento, pero jamás ha sido
    aprobada ninguna versión final.
  • 1979

    Primer RDBMS comercial Oracle V2.
  • 1980

    Se funda Informix (3° generación de DBMS), cerca de 10000 usando DBMS en EEUU.
    Para PC Paradox. Evolución del modelo relacional.
  • 1981

    IBM comenzó a comercializar el SQL.
    La pequeña compañía Ashton- Tate introduce DBASE II (no es de DBMS, es de
    archivos).
    Las facilidades de Codasyl incluyen un lenguaje de descripción de datos (DDL) de
    subesquema y un correspondiente Lenguaje de Manipulación de Datos (DML) Cobol JoD
    de 1981.
  • 1982

    Inician los esfuerzos de ANSI SQL.
  • 1983

    Oracle libera sus primera DBMS que corren en mainframes, minicomputadoras y PC’s.
    IBM lanzó al mercado su producto DATABASE2, más conocido por su abreviatura DB2.
    Se disolvió la principal comisión Codasyl que se ocupaba del modelo, porque terminó su
    objetivo al crear un modelo con éxito, que ANSI tomó a su cargo para estandarizar.
  • 1984

    Ashton- Tate introduce DB III.
    El trabajo sobre el modelo de res (ANSI, 1984 a,b,c y d) basado en el modelo Codasyl,
    está casi completo, mientras que el modelo relacional (ANSI/SPARC 1984) está todavía
    en la etapa inicial (Gallagher, 1984).
  • 1985

    Comenzaron a conectar las computadoras por medio de redes de área local (LAN).
    IBM introduce DB2 para maxicomputadoras o mainframes bajo Sistema Operativo MVS.
  • 1986

    Informix pasa a ser una compañía pública.
    Oracle libera su primer DBMS con capacidades de distribución.
    Se publica el estándar ANSI SQL.
    El Dr. Date define BD distribuidas.
    SQL fue adaptado como el estándar ANSI (American Nacional Standarts Institute), para
    los lenguajes de DB relacionales.
    Los lenguajes usados son: SQL Structure Quero Language, QUEL Query Language, qbe
    Query By Example.
    DB orientadas a objetos.
  • 1987

    ISO (International Standards Organization) adopta el estándar SQL.
  • 1988

    Se libera SQL Server para OS/2 por parte de Microsoft y SyBase. Libera Oracle V6.
    Ashton-Tate introduce DBASE IV. Ontologic lanza Vbase.
    Simbolics introdujo Static (apoyo a inteligencia artificial como LISP – Lenguaje de
    procesamiento de Listas).
  • 1989

    ANSI-89 SQL. El estándar fue actualizado.
    Se forma SQL Access Group. Se utiliza la arquitectura cliente/servidor y plataforma
    común.
    Segunda etapa de SGBDOO.
  • 1990

    Ashton-Tate introduce dBase IV.
    Tercera generación de BD 0.0 (Integridad en forma más rápida y simple), sobre todo en
    áreas de investigación.
  • 1991

    Modelo orientado a objetos (autores: Jeffcoate, Guilfoyle y Deutsch).
    Oracle alcanza el poder de 1000 TPS en una máquina de cómputo paralelo.
    Las bases de objetos (también conocidas como bases de datos orientadas a objetos o bases
    de datos objetuales).
    El ODMG (Object Management Group, hoy día Object Data Management).
  • 1992

    ANSI – 92 SQL
    Triggers (disparador: acciones ejecutadas automáticamente).
    SQL Access Group publica las especificaciones CLIENTE.
    Microsoft libera ODBC 1.0 para Windows.
  • 1993

    Oracle implanta DB distribuidas.
    Access puede trabajar con datos dependientes de dBase, Paradox, Foxpro.
    Paradox 4.0 de Borland anuncia PAL (Paradox Applications Language for Windows).
    SyBase anuncio la versión 10.0, una versión completamente nueva de SQL Server y sin intervención de Microsoft.
    Libera Oracle 7 para Unix. Se desarrolla un Ambiente de Desarrollo Cooperativo (CDE)
    de Oracle.
    Microsoft libera su versión de SQL Server de 32 para Windows NT.
  • 1994

    FoxPro Microsoft.
    Microsoft libera ODBC 2.0 para Windows.
    Liberan Oracle 7 para PC.
    En abril Microsoft anunció que se desarrollaría su propio producto servidor de bases de
    datos. Las versiones posteriores de Microsoft SQL Server traían recuerdos de SQL Server
    de SyBase. Microsoft permite portar las especificaciones de ODBC a otras plataformas no
    Windows por parte de Visigenic Software.
    ODBC 2.0 SDK es disponible para los UNIX de SUN. HP e IBM.
    SQL Access Group se fusiona con X/Open.
  • 1995

    Se anuncia DB2/2 de IBM.
    Oracle 7.1.
    SQL Server 6.0 de Microsoft (puede trabajar con Access, Lotus Approach y Borland
    Paradox).
    En este año Informix tenía el 34.5% del mercado RDBMS para UNIX.
    El SDK de ODBC está disponible para SCO UNIX, OS/2, Macintosh y Power Macintosh.
  • 1996

    Mejor DB Oracle 7.2.
    Oracle Parallel Server incrementa performance introduciendo operaciones en paralelo y
    asíncronas.
    Oracle Universal Server transfiere desde PC a poderosos servidores de redes.
    Oracle 8 está en versión Beta.
    Javasoft está preparando una especificación para unir aplicaciones Java con Bases de
    Datos relacionales.
  • 1997

    Herramientas OLAP (On Line Analitical Processing) ventajas de BD en bloques de tres
    dimensiones. Oracle se encuentra en la versión 8.i, SQL server de SyBase en la 11 y SQL
    Server de Microsoft en la 6.5.
    Se introducen nuevos conceptos en las bases de datos como: Datawarehousing (formulada
    por bases de datos que pueden manejar una cantidad enorme de información), bases de
    datos orientadas a objetos, JDBC (Java Data Base Connectivity) éste en un API que une a Java con la Bases de datos.
  • 1999

    Se publica SQL2000 en el que se agregan expresiones regulares, consultas recursivas
    (para relaciones jerárquicas), triggers y algunas características orientadas a objetos.
  • 2001

    Command Prompt, Inc. lanzó Mammonth PostgreSQL, la más antigua distribución
    comercial de PostgreSQL.
  • 2003

    SQL introduce algunas características de XML, cambios en las funciones, estandarización
    del objeto sequence y de las columnas autonuméricas.
  • 2006

    La norma ISO/IEC 9075-14:2006 define las maneras en las cuales el SQL se puede
    utilizar conjuntamente con XML. Define maneras de importar y guardar datos XML en una base de datos SQL. Facilita el manejo de aplicaciones para integrar es uso de
    XQuery dentro del código SQL, para el uso concurrente a datos ordinarios.
  • 2007

    EnterpriseDB anunció el Postgres Resource Center y EnterpriseDB Postgres, diseñados
    para ser una completamente configurada distribución de PostgreSQL incluyendo muchos
    módulos contribuidos y agregados
  • 2008

    Se introduce el uso de la cláusula ORDER BY en SQL2008